What is Western Digital EV-to-FCF?

EV-to-FCF is calculated as enterprise value divided by its free cash flow. As of today, Western Digital's Enterprise Value is €18,660 Mil. Western Digital's Free Cash Flow for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2024 was €420 Mil. Therefore, Western Digital's EV-to-FCF for today is 44.41.

Western Digital EV-to-FCF Calculation

Western Digital's EV-to-FCF for today is calculated as:

EV-to-FCF=Enterprise Value (Today)/Free Cash Flow (TTM)
=18659.737/420.199
=44.41

Western Digital's current Enterprise Value is €18,660 Mil.
Western Digital's Free Cash Flow for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2024 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was €420 Mil.

Enterprise Value is used because it is a more complete measure in reflecting how much an investor pays when buying a company. Free Cash Flow is an important financial metric because it represents the actual amount of cash at a company's disposal. Companies with a low EV-to-FCF ratio, combined with a strong balance sheet are generally considered as undervalued.

Western Digital Business Description

Address
5601 Great Oaks Parkway, San Jose, CA, USA, 95119
Western Digital is a leading, vertically integrated supplier of hard disk drives. The HDD market is a practical duopoly with, Western Digital and Seagate being the two largest players. Western Digital designs and manufacturers its HDDs, with much of the manufacturing and workforce located in Asia. The primary consumers of HDDs are data centers.
